    Easy Clipboard Organizer

    Easy Clipboard Organizer

    Open, extendable and eye candy clipboard manager.

    Easy Clipboard Organizer is an open, extendable and eye candy clipboard manager. You can browse history of copied texts and files, translate selected text, simultaneously paste files from different directories or save part of the screen to clipboard or file. By using plugins and themes you can customize the functionality and appearance to your needs. If you are an office worker, programmer, student or you are just working with texts or files - ECO will make your life easier.

    Genius clipboard manager

    Genius clipboard manager

    powerful clipboard manager for windows

    Genius monitors system clipboard and saves its content. and it provides 2 basic interfaces to select items from the history Saved clipboard can be later copied and pasted directly into any application. Clipboard data saved into the history cannot change later. and Genius not change or edit data . clipboard data is restored without changing a single bit
